The main undergraduate program in Aerospace Engineering in Kolkata usually lasts 4 years. This is the standard duration for most Bachelor of Technology (B.Tech) or Bachelor of Engineering (B.E.) degrees in this field. These 4 years are divided into 8 semesters. During this time, you learn subjects like aerodynamics, propulsion, aircraft design, materials science, and flight mechanics. You also get hands-on experience with labs and projects.
In some rare cases or special programs, the duration can extend up to 5 years. This may happen if the college offers extra practical training or industry internships as part of the course. But most core programs stay at 4 years.
A 4-year schedule gives you enough time to grow both in theory and practice. The first two years often cover basics of math, physics, and engineering. The later years focus more on aerospace-specific skills like aircraft systems and design projects. This balanced structure helps students build strong foundations and prepare for jobs or higher studies.
This time frame also matches national engineering standards across India. Most entrance exams and academic calendars are based on a 4-year engineering plan. So whether you aim for jobs or master’s programs later, this duration fits well into your career path.
